Insectoacaricides
Their impact may be:
- contact - destroy on touch;
- intestinal - enter the body
- fumigant - pests are poisoned in pairs;
- systemic – get into plants and become food for mites.
Insectoacaricides have:
- toxicity;
- high efficiency;
- prone to rapid disintegration;
- inability to accumulate in cells.

How often to apply
The sprayed preparations retain their effect for a long time. Some are active for up to 1,5 months. Garden plots are treated 1-2 times during the season, and recreation areas - 1 time per year.
What to consider when choosing
When choosing funds, you must:
- purchase suitable drugs;
- consider compatibility with other formulations;
- pay attention to the expiration date;
- determine the class of toxicity, as well as the impact on people, animals, fish;
- take into account the possibility of habituation of insects.
How long does the effect last
The activity of funds most often lasts no more than one season. One treatment provides an excellent result on the site. The peculiarity of ticks is survivability and rapid adaptation.
At the first treatments, a rapid action is noted. But over time, it weakens. Ticks become resistant. It is best to use one substance for one season and use another the next. Treatment with two drugs is prohibited so that they do not block the action of each other.

Plot processing
Site treatment recommendations:
- alternate different compositions so that stability does not appear;
- drugs are used twice a year: the first time at the end of April - May, and the second - at the end of October - November;
- carry out the procedure in dry calm weather, having previously studied the forecast;
- remove tools and things away;
- children and pets should not be present on the site;
- use protective equipment. After that they are thrown away;
- spraying of trees and shrubs should be at a level not higher than 1,5 m. Pests can climb a maximum of this height;
- it is desirable to carry out manipulation together with neighbors;
- it is not recommended to visit the site for 3 days.
The use of acaricides indoors
A few tips for handling indoors:
- the procedure is carried out in protective clothing - a long robe, high shoes, a hat, rubber gloves, a respirator, glasses;
- dilute and prepare the composition on an open surface or in a room with good ventilation;
- avoid drafts by closing doors and windows;
- prepare the compositions in special containers. Dishes and food should be as far away as possible;
- children, animals, strangers are prohibited from being disinfected;
- carry out wet cleaning and ventilate the room after 2 hours.
Treatment of hives with acaricides
Hives also sometimes need to be treated for ticks. However, most drugs are toxic to them. Such products are forbidden to be used so as not to destroy beneficial insects. In hives, Fumisan, Aifit, Apistan can be used.
Impact on the environment, people and pets
Substances can be:
- specific - for the destruction of ticks;
- insectoacaricides - eliminate various insects.
The degree of impact on people is divided into 4 hazard classes:
- 1st class - the use of the most dangerous substances is possible only indoors (Magtoxin, Phostoxin);
- 2nd class - only animal feed is treated with highly hazardous substances (Marshal, Tanrek, Aktellik, BIFI);
- 3rd class - classified as moderately dangerous means. They have a low degree of toxicity, but they pose a danger to bees, reptiles and fish (Dichlorvos, Sumitrin, Karbofos, Phenaksin);
- 4th class - the weakest drugs. The disintegration of the components occurs within a few days (Vermitek, Fitoverm, Akarin).
The degree of danger depends on:
- toxicity;
- carcinogenicity;
- effects on embryos;
- degree of irritation of the mucous membranes.
